The top management of the company contends that Hafstrom would benefit most from manufacturing its own parts, rather than sourcing it from elsewhere, even if they are made at another location overseas.
 
  Which of the following is being recommended in this approach?
  A) just-in-time manufacturing
  B) location economies
  C) vertical integration
  D) outsourcing

Question 2

Which of the following was an advantage of the gold standard?
 
  A) It retained trade imbalances.
  B) It abolished monetary policies on all countries.
  C) It reduced the risk in exchange rates.
  D) It increased exchange-rate fluctuations.
